| k4mr411 wrote: |
4-2-1 Manifold (I thinking of buying the Ebay One.. Can Anyone Tell me IF there Any Good and Worth the Money?)
|
The ebay "Japspeed" manifolds are just SS copies of the stock manifold, they offer no performance increase, just a bit of engine bay bling (untill they rust). _________________
